A tale of two rides

It is amazing how different two rides in the same week can be. A few weeks ago I was planning on doing my first time trial as a way to get back into racing in a way that would be very unlikely to result in a crash. The weekend before I had done some very good hard rides and my legs were feeling good. I was unable to do my usual Monday night recovery ride because I got stuck on campus later than I should have been. By Wednesday I went out on my usual KOW (king of Wednesday) ride (race) and my legs felt horrible. I got dropped much earlier than I had wanted. After a slow ride home I decided that it was not worth the $40 and getting up at 4am on Saturday to drive 2 hours to go to a 40K time trial just to come in dead last.

That Saturday I got up to do my usual ride and felt much stronger than I expected. In fact I stayed on to the lead pack about 10 miles longer that usual. My best Saturday ride the year!

I was disappointed with not racing that day until I looked at the time for the cat 5 racers and the winning time was around 1 hour. I know that I could not have finished in 1 hour so I felt ok with my decision. Hopefully some consistent training over the next couple of months will put me in good shape for a possible TT in the fall.
